王佳豪
2021-05-29 190f37c6a989dd17dc20a61eb271a81ee0902393
src/main/java/zy/cloud/wms/common/service/erp/ErpService.java
@@ -11,8 +11,10 @@
import zy.cloud.wms.common.service.erp.entity.UploadBillDetail;
import zy.cloud.wms.manager.entity.DocType;
import zy.cloud.wms.manager.entity.Mat;
import zy.cloud.wms.manager.entity.RequestLog;
import zy.cloud.wms.manager.service.DocTypeService;
import zy.cloud.wms.manager.service.MatService;
import zy.cloud.wms.manager.service.RequestLogService;
import zy.cloud.wms.manager.utils.HttpHandler;
import java.util.ArrayList;
@@ -30,6 +32,8 @@
    private DocTypeService docTypeService;
    @Autowired
    private MatService matService;
    @Autowired
    private RequestLogService requestLogService;
    /**
     * 单据上报
     */
@@ -74,6 +78,14 @@
                    .build()
                    .doPost();
            // 日志记录
            RequestLog logInfo = new RequestLog();
            logInfo.setName("单据上传,单据类型" + docId.toString());
            logInfo.setRequest(JSON.toJSONString(uploadBill)); // 入参
            logInfo.setResponse(response); // 出参
            logInfo.setCreateTime(new Date());
            requestLogService.insert(logInfo);
            if (!Cools.isEmpty(response)) {
                log.warn(response);
                Result result = JSON.parseObject(response, Result.class);